Transaction f76558c6cb26b1905c30d751362f594c8b95712c3861eeb05935880237eadb36
1 Input
1 Output
-
f76558c6cb26b1905c30d751362f594c8b95712c3861eeb05935880237eadb36:0
- value
- 27298401
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ea9e8fc35f5a7b4458cb4f056ee958b9cddd326e OP_EQUAL
- address
- 3P5ZzUzYAYyLtiRCavPcvTjLgeDXA2vsHZ